Isabella Bank (NASDAQ:ISBA) Director Brian Roy Sackett Purchases 403 Shares of Stock

Isabella Bank Corporation (NASDAQ:ISBAGet Free Report) Director Brian Roy Sackett acquired 403 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, January 20th. The shares were bought at an average cost of $49.58 per share, with a total value of $19,980.74. Following the completion of the transaction, the director owned 4,159 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$206,203.22. This represents a 10.73% increase in their position. Isabella Bank (NASDAQ: ISBA) is a community bank headquartered in Mount Pleasant, Michigan, serving individuals and businesses across mid-Michigan. The bank delivers a broad array of financial products, including checking and savings accounts, money market accounts, certificates of deposit, and online and mobile banking platforms designed to meet everyday banking needs.

On the commercial side, Isabella Bank offers business lending solutions such as lines of credit, term loans, and equipment financing, alongside treasury management, merchant services, and payroll processing to help companies manage cash flow and streamline operations.
